Mincoffs Solicitors and Naylors Gavin Black act on £5m sale
Mincoffs Solicitors and Naylors Gavin Black have worked together to complete the £5.425m sale of the Q5 building in Quorum Business Park, Longbenton, to a group of private investors.
Q5 comprises more than 70,000 square feet across four floors and recently welcomed new tenants including Lindisfarne Inns – part of the Inn Collection Group – and Mandata Management and Data Services, which have both moved into suites on the building’s third floor.
Other tenants at the building include Pure Gym, ROSEN(UK) and Advertising Intelligence, with two further offices which are ready to let on the ground and first floors.
The vacant lots offer further revenue generation opportunities for the new owners, including more than 6000 square feet of Grade A office space – with offices available from 2000 square feet – and plans for additional investment, including LED light fittings and improvements to the lobby area.
Naylors Gavin Black’s relationship with the new owners will continue as it has been appointed to market the part first floor offices of the high spec building, which also boasts an impressive entrance hall with full height atrium
